Inspection History
Nov 30, 2022
Routine - Food
3 minor violations.
View 3 violations
Basic - Cutting board has cut marks and is no longer cleanable. On reach in cooler.
14-09-4
Basic - Nonfood-contact surface soiled with grease, food debris, dirt, slime or dust. Hoods and sides of flattop soiled with grease.
23-03-4
Basic - Single-service articles not stored inverted or protected from contamination. **Corrected On-Site**
25-06-4
